چکیده    Curcumin is among the herbal substances that are of high significance for many researchers as a wound dressing and a wound-healing substance. curcumin's functioning can be substantially improved by its blending with other natural and industrial components. a systematic review was conducted by searching queries in reliable databases, including scopus, web of sciences, and pubmed. the search results were screened by two researchers employing the preferred reporting items for systematic reviews and meta-analysis (prisma) algorithm. a total of 320 studies were identified, of which 11 were chosen for evidence synthesis. according to the studies, the antimicrobial effect (in 8 studies), mechanical properties (in 7 studies), electrospinning (in 8 studies), and cytotoxicity (in 6 studies) in wound dressings were parameters significantly influenced by blending curcumin with other herbal components and chemical polymers. according to the evidence synthesis results, herbal compounds combined with curcumin improve and strengthen the wound healing property of curcumin.
